• (adv.) In a possible manner; by possible means; especially, by extreme, remote, or improbable intervention, change, or exercise of power; by a chance; perhaps; as, possibly he may recover.

adverb with a possibility of becoming actual; `introducing possibly dangerous innovations`; `he is potentially dangerous`; `potentially useful`
